Water Leaks

A window that is leaking could cause expensive damage to the walls and ceilings. This is why it's imperative to act quickly when you notice water leaks through your windows. The weather seals on uPVC windows are usually faulty and can be easily repaired. If you suspect this is the issue you should invest in new caulking. Apply a new coat. This is a simple and inexpensive home repair that will save you money in the long run.

Condensation within the window is a common sign of a leaky window. This may not be as bad as a leak of water however it is a sign that the window no longer provides an effective barrier to insulate. This could be a significant problem during the winter months.

It is important to inspect your window on both the outside and inside of your house. Check for indications of water damage and stains. Also, check the sill angle to ensure that rainwater is able to escape from the windows. Check for any damaged flashing. This is the material that is put on the frame to block water from getting into the walls and uPVC window repairs ceiling.

Faulty Hinges

Window hinges require regular maintenance. They can wear out and damaged, which makes it difficult to open or shut the window. It is essential to have your window hinges repaired in the earliest time possible when you encounter an issue. This will keep your home secure from weather or from unauthorised entry.

If your uPVC window isn't closing correctly, it may be because the hinges are worn out. This is a common issue and can be easily fixed by following a few easy steps. You'll first need to remove the hinges from the frame. Then you will need to replace the hinges with new ones. When replacing the hinges, make sure you use the right type of screws and that they are installed correctly. It is also crucial to determine the size of the screw threads since uPVC frames are different sizes than timber frames.

Stuck Handles

If a uPVC window has become stuck it could be due to an issue with the mechanism or handle. The mechanisms can be fixed in a relatively quick time, and ensure that the windows will continue to function as they should. It is also crucial to make sure that uPVC windows are regularly cleaned and maintained in order to avoid any issues arising.

The most common types of uPVC window handle are espagnolette handles. They feature a multipoint locking mechanism which increases the security of your window. They utilize locks that are shaped like mushrooms to secure the window frames. Most of the time, the handle will be capable of opening and closing the window without any issues, but if you are experiencing issues with the handle getting stuck then there may be a problem with the spindle within the handle that is causing the problem.

It is a good thing that replacing a uPVC window handle is a relatively simple task that is achievable by almost anyone with a basic set of tools and knowledge. To replace a handle effectively it is necessary to first determine the type of handle you want to replace and then take a measurement of the spindle. Then, you can purchase an alternative handle that is the exact same size as the current one. When you have the appropriate tools and the new part will not be more than 30 minutes.
